A-20 Production Line at Douglas Long Beach During WWII

Douglas Aircraft built a variety of warplanes, including light attack series A-20 and A-26, which required assembly of 165,000 parts. The Douglas Long beach Plant built 2,502 of these planes at a cost of $182,892 each.
